REAL SOCIEDAD 3-2 ATHLETIC CLUB

Derby glory

Vídeo

Real Sociedad secured victory in this afternoon’s Derby at Anoeta, defeating Athletic Club 3-2. The txuri-urdin, who had gone ahead on two separate occasions, clinched the winning goal in stoppage time with a spectacular thunderbolt from Gorrotxa, capping a dramatic finish.

The derby kicked off with the intense energy typical of such encounters. After a cautious start, Soler tested Simón with a first-time left-footed strike from Brais’ cross, which the Athletic keeper managed to push out for a corner. Shortly afterward, Oyarzabal had a close chance, but his shot went just wide. The visitors offered a timid response around the half-hour mark, with Guruzeta heading over the bar. Minutes later, on their third attempt, Real Sociedad broke the deadlock: a slick combination between Oyarzabal, Guedes, and an injured Barrene saw the ball played into the box, the captain nudged it with his knee, it fell to Brais, whose shot Simón blocked, only for the Galician to calmly finish into an empty net and put the txuri-urdin ahead. The lead was short-lived, however, as in another swift move, Galarreta whipped in a free-kick, Gorosabel controlled it and squared it for Guruzeta, who leveled the score just before halftime.

The second half got off to a perfect start: Brais provided the assist, Guedes executed a clever self-pass to get past Laporte, and then fired a powerful right-footed strike into the net to put the txuri urdin back in front. Real Sociedad seemed to have added a third through Zakharyan, but unfortunately, Take was slightly offside at the start of the move. A frustrating blow for the home side. Laporte came close to equalizing with a precise header from Navarro’s cross, but couldn’t connect cleanly. Moments later, the Athletic forward seized a rebound inside the box to finally bring the score level. Just when a draw seemed inevitable, Gorrotxa appeared in the area and unleashed a sensational shot into the back of the net, securing victory for Real. Ecstasy. Chaos at Anoeta.

Match Details:

Real Sociedad: A. Remiro, Aramburu, Jon Martín, Zubeldia, Sergio Gómez, Gorrotxa, C. Soler (Goti, 82’), Brais Méndez (Marín, 63’), Barrene [Zakharyan, 41’ (Aihen, 82’)], Guedes (Take, 63’) and Oyarzabal (capt.).

Athletic Club: Unai Simón, Gorosabel (Areso, 82’), Vivian, Laporte, Yuri (capt.), Jaureguizar, R. de Galarreta (Rego, 68’), Berenguer, O. Sancet (Williams Jr., 53’), Navarro and Guruzeta.

Goals: 1-0: Brais Méndez, 38’; 1-1: Guruzeta, 42’; 2-1: Guedes, 47’; 2-2: Navarro, 79’; 3-2: Gorrotxa, 92’.

Referee: José Luis Munuera. Booked Gorrotxa for Real Sociedad and R. de Galarreta and Yuri for Athletic.

Attendance: 37,685 spectators.
